Output 25b98500824fbd36774e94e70effca116d4a36ecc2baf781617fbff1f0e16f7a:2

value
42156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88d1ff91eab36e5792963cea570ad0a54a9c83d OP_EQUAL
address
3KyS8SSYqaLu2qeWZENB9kd5TxN6wHcorJ
transaction
25b98500824fbd36774e94e70effca116d4a36ecc2baf781617fbff1f0e16f7a
spent
true